Marvin's obituary
Rev. Marvin Eugene Durham, 69, of 429 Sarratt Avenue, went home to be with the Lord on Sunday, June 29, 2008 at Spartanburg Regional Medical Center.
Born in Blacksburg, he was the husband of Martha White Durham and the son of the late Dever Durham and Mary Parker Durham. Mr. Durham was the pastor of Tabernacle of Love in Chesnee for over 33 years.
Surviving in addition to his spouse are five sons, Johnny Smith, Billy Smith and Michael Durham and wife Angela of Gaffney, Marvin (Pete) Durham, Jr. and wife Deborah of Chesnee and Guy Durham and wife Jan of Spartanburg; three daughters, Kathy Suddeth and husband Dale of Chesnee, Melissa Jackson of Greer and Tabitha Taylor and husband Chris of Gaffney; two brothers, Roy Durham of Rock Hill and Fred Durham and wife Maxine of Myrtle Beach; five sisters Lula Mae Peeler, Nancy Porter and husband Henry, Ponice Willard, Pauline Ramsey and husband Gaithern of Gaffney and Betty Jean Bradley of Pacolet; 22 grandchildren and 24 great-grandchildren. Mr. Durham was predeceased by a son, Ken Durham; a sister, Ruby Sparks; a grandson, Jonathan Suddeth; and a brother J. D. Durham.
